Kaspersen, Eivind, 2021, "Eye-tracking data for classification of geometric shapes", https://doi.org/10.18710/TEJDSF, DataverseNO, V1
Eye-tracking data for geometric classification tasks for abstract and non-abstract thinking. How to develop and assess abstraction processes are longstanding methodical problems in mathematics education. Bremnes, Heming Strømholt, 2021, "Data for ‘Computational Complexity Explains Neural Differences in Quantifier Verification’", https://doi.org/10.18710/M6VT6Z, DataverseNO, V1
Different classes of quantifiers provably require different verification algorithms with different complexity profiles. The algorithm for proportional quantifiers, like `most', is more complex than that for nonproportional quantifiers, like `all' and `three'.
